Given the rural roads and hot, humid climate, common issues include suspension wear from uneven surfaces, overheating and cooling system problems, and accelerated battery failure. Dust and debris from unpaved roads can also lead to clogged air filters and premature wear on brakes and tires.

While parts costs are similar, labor rates in Marietta can sometimes be more competitive due to lower overhead, but selection is more limited. For highly specialized repairs, you may need to travel to a larger service center, which adds travel cost to the overall price comparison.
Seek immediate service for warning lights (like check engine or overheating), strange noises/steering issues on our rural roads, or brake problems. Schedule routine check-ups before long drives on highways like US-59 or seasonal changes, especially before summer to test your AC and cooling system.
Yes, regularly inspect your vehicle's undercarriage for damage from rough or unpaved county roads. Also, due to the proximity to lakes and humidity, be vigilant about rust prevention and check for it during oil changes, especially on older vehicles.
